Item 5.02.  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

 

On June 9, 2014, 3M Company issued a press release announcing the appointment of Nicholas C. Gangestad as Senior Vice President and Chief Financial Officer, effective immediately.  Mr. Gangestad replaces David W. Meline who is leaving the Company to take a position as chief financial officer at another large publicly-traded company.

 

Mr. Gangestad, 49, has served as the Company’s Vice President, Corporate Controller and Chief Accounting Officer since April 2011.  Prior to that, Mr. Gangestad had served as Director of Corporate Accounting from 2007 to March 31, 2011 and as Director of Finance and I.T., 3M Canada from 2003 to 2007.

 

In his position as Chief Financial Officer, Mr. Gangestad will receive an annual base salary of $523,523, and be eligible for annual incentive compensation with a target amount of $523,523.  The amount of Mr. Gangestad’s actual annual incentive compensation, which will be paid under the Company’s Executive Annual Incentive Plan, may be more or less than this target amount, depending on the future performance of the Company.

 

He will also participate in the Company’s long-term incentive compensation programs, retirement and welfare benefits and services offered to the Company’s senior executive officers.
